Comprehensive Service Overview

When a garage door stops working properly, the scope of what needs to happen depends heavily on the specific problem—and on the conditions unique to your property.

Spring and cable issues are among the most common repairs in Nakina. The high-tension springs that counterbalance your door’s weight endure constant stress, and the local humidity can accelerate rust and metal fatigue. Replacing these safely involves precise tension adjustments and proper matching to your door’s weight. Similarly, frayed or snapped cables need careful replacement to restore smooth lifting.

Track and roller problems often show up in homes where settling has shifted the door frame slightly. An off-track door can be alarming, but the remedy typically involves realigning the tracks, adjusting brackets, and replacing any damaged rollers. A thorough inspection of the entire system usually follows to catch any developing issues.

Opener troubleshooting covers a wide range of possibilities, from dead remotes and unresponsive keypads to motor failures on units from brands like LiftMaster, Chamberlain, or Genie. Many issues are straightforward to diagnose—sensor alignment, power supply, or wiring problems—while others may require component replacement.

Routine maintenance checks are often part of a service visit. After completing a repair, a multi-point inspection of rollers, tracks, sensors, and door balance helps confirm everything is operating safely. This kind of check can catch small problems before they become bigger ones.

Storm-related wear is another consideration in this region. After heavy weather, doors may shift, seals may loosen, or sensors may need recalibrating. A post-storm assessment can provide useful peace of mind.

Throughout the process, the emphasis is on clear communication—understanding what’s needed, why, and what your options are before any work begins.

Regional Characteristics

Nakina sits in the coastal plain region of southeastern North Carolina, characterized by flat terrain, sandy soils, and dense pine and hardwood forests. Housing stock in the area is a mix of older ranch-style homes, manufactured homes, and newer single-family builds. Many properties feature detached garages or carports, and the rural nature of the area means garages often serve as workshops or storage spaces in addition to vehicle parking. The humid climate and occasional tropical storm impacts mean garage doors and their components experience steady moisture exposure, temperature swings, and the occasional wind event.

Common Issues

Homeowners in the Nakina area commonly encounter spring fatigue and breakage due to humidity and daily cycling, cable fraying or snapping from rust accumulation, and off-track doors caused by impact or gradual wear. Opener malfunctions—particularly with older units or budget models—are frequent, especially after power surges or extended use. Sensor misalignment from settling foundations or accidental bumps is another regular concern, along with weather stripping deterioration from sun and moisture exposure.
